Output 8c367cb0ae89c700204ea0c0debe08a915a50fcb620667a5b4256cab75023ac6:36

value
57800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f2d958bb04c5c881dfe71a896b810b15a8191fc OP_EQUAL
address
37T56sYQgN55xn3pPnut2JUmke48YsY3M2
transaction
8c367cb0ae89c700204ea0c0debe08a915a50fcb620667a5b4256cab75023ac6
confirmations
259176
spent
true